响应式网站设计是关键,它确保网站在各种设备和屏幕尺寸上均高效、直观且友好,实现此目标需掌握其四大核心技巧:1.流动栅格布局使页面随屏幕大小灵活调整;2.灵活图片和媒体查询确保内容适配多种设备;3.可访问性强调让网站对所有人开放,包括残障人士;4.快速加载时间优化性能,提升用户体验和满意度,这些技巧将打造强大、适应性强的响应式网站。
随着互联网的快速发展,网站已经成为企业展示形象、提供服务的重要平台,响应式网站设计,作为一种新兴的设计理念,正逐渐受到广大开发者和用户的青睐,本文将探讨响应式网站设计的关键技巧,以帮助开发者创建更为出色的用户体验。
理解响应式设计的本质
响应式设计是一种设计方法论,旨在使网站能够根据不同设备和屏幕尺寸自动调整布局、内容和功能,通过采用媒体查询、流式布局、移动优先等关键技术,开发者能够确保网站在各种环境下都能提供良好的浏览体验。
掌握关键的布局技巧
-
使用流式布局:流式布局使页面元素能够根据屏幕尺寸自动调整宽度,保持网页内容的整体性和流动性,这对于移动设备尤为重要,因为它能减少用户在移动设备上的阅读压力。
-
采用弹性图片和媒体:通过设置图片的最大宽度为100%,并使用响应式图片技术(如srcset属性),可以确保图片在不同屏幕尺寸下都能保持合适的大小和比例。
-
合理利用CSS Grid和Flexbox:CSS Grid和Flexbox是现代CSS布局模块,它们提供了更灵活和强大的布局能力,利用这些特性,开发者可以轻松创建响应式的布局结构。
优化导航和交互设计
-
设计可折叠的导航栏:在移动设备上,导航栏可能需要收缩以节省空间,通过使用CSS媒体查询和JavaScript实现交互功能,可以创建简洁且易于使用的导航体验。
-
响应式按钮和链接:确保按钮和链接在不同屏幕尺寸下都能保持足够的可见性和可点击性,通过使用CSS媒体查询调整样式和位置,可以提供更直观的用户交互体验。
利用前端框架增强响应式设计
-
Bootstrap等框架:Bootstrap等前端框架提供了预定义的响应式组件和工具类,开发者可以直接应用这些类来快速构建响应式布局。
-
自定义主题和插件:根据项目需求,可以定制框架的默认样式和组件,或者开发自定义插件来扩展其功能。
测试和优化
-
跨浏览器测试:确保网站在不同浏览器(如Chrome、Firefox、Safari等)中都能正常工作,以提供一致的用户体验。
-
性能优化:通过压缩图片、合并CSS和JavaScript文件、使用CDN等技术手段,提高网站的加载速度和响应时间。
响应式网站设计并非一蹴而就的过程,它需要开发者持续学习和实践,通过掌握上述关键技巧并不断优化和改进,开发者可以创建出真正适用于各种设备和场景的响应式网站。
响应式网站设计是现代互联网发展的必然趋势,只有掌握了响应式设计的关键技巧并不断探索创新,才能为用户提供更加卓越、便捷的网络体验,让我们共同努力,迎接更加美好的数字未来吧!